Gerald Gardner (Jerry) Obituary
Madison, OH - Gerald L. (Jerry) Gardner age 80 passed away July 2, 2025. He was born February 21, 1945 in Ashtabula to Alfred and Mary Sue Gardner.
Jerry is survived by nieces and nephews, Kevin Childs, Ronald (Michelle) Childs Jr, Lori (Randy) Laslow, Shelley (Tim) Tyler, Trisha (Geoffrey) Gardner McCall and Staci Gardner Carey. He is predeceased by his parents; sister, Sherill and brother, Charles.
Jerry attended Ashtabula City Schools and graduated from Ashtabula High School in the class of 1963. After working as a road freight brakeman on the New York Central Railroad, he then worked on iron ore trains to Youngstown and other runs into PA. Jerry went to Indiana Tech in Fort Wayne, IN. and graduated from Indiana Tech in 1968 with a Bachelor of Science in Mechanical Engineering and went to work for CEI in a number of engineering positions related to power plant performance,construction and system design. Jerry retired from CEI in 1993, taking an early retirement buyout offered by CEI.
He then joined a retiree lunch group known as the "Dinosaurs" that met twice a month at various eateries in Lake and Cuyahoga counties. In his spare time he enjoyed taking day bus trips with his "bus buddy" Debbie, spinning and going to the fitness center where he maintained an active lifestyle.
